#217068 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#217068 is composed of 12.9% red, 43.9% green and 40.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 70.5% cyan, 0% magenta, 7.1% yellow and 56.1% black. It has a hue angle of 173.9 degrees, a saturation of 54.5% and a lightness of 28.4%. #217068 color hex could be obtained by blending #42e0d0 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#336666.

#217068 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#217068 has RGB values of R:33, G:112, B:104 and CMYK values of C:0.71, M:0, Y:0.07, K:0.56. Its decimal value is 2191464.

Shades and Tints of #217068
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020606 is the darkest color, while #f6fcfc is the lightest one.
